_Message PSM GETRESULT

Utilisé par les feuilles de propriétés non modales pour récupérer les informations retournées aux feuilles de propriétés modales par feuille. Vous pouvez envoyer ce message explicitement ou utiliser la macro PropSheet _ GetResult .

Paramètres

wParam

Doit être zéro.

lParam

Doit être zéro.

Valeur de retour

Retourne une valeur positive en cas de réussite, ou-1 dans le cas contraire. Les valeurs de retour suivantes ont une signification particulière.

Code de retour Description
ID _ PSREBOOTSYSTEM
Une page a envoyé un message PSM _ REBOOTSYSTEM à la feuille de propriétés. L’ordinateur doit être redémarré pour que les modifications apportées à l’utilisateur prennent effet.
ID _ PSRESTARTWINDOWS
Une page a envoyé un message PSM _ RESTARTWINDOWS à la feuille de propriétés. Windows doit être redémarré pour que les modifications apportées à l’utilisateur prennent effet.

Notes

Pour récupérer les informations d’erreur étendues, appelez GetLastError.

La valeur de retour de ce message est identique à celle que feuille retourne pour une feuille de propriétés modale.

Version 5,80. La valeur de retour feuille transporte des informations différentes pour les feuilles de propriétés modales et non modales. Dans certains cas, les feuilles de propriétés non modales peuvent avoir besoin des informations qu’elles auraient reçues de feuille si elles avaient été modales. En particulier, il peut être nécessaire de savoir si l’ID _ PSREBOOTSYSTEM ou l’ID _ PSRESTARTWINDOWS aurait été retourné.

Pour une feuille de propriétés non modale, votre boucle de messages doit utiliser des _ ISDIALOGMESSAGE PSM pour transmettre des messages à la boîte de dialogue de la feuille de propriétés, et PSM _ GETCURRENTPAGEHWND pour déterminer quand détruire la boîte de dialogue. Quand l’utilisateur clique sur le bouton OK ou Annuler , PSM _ GETCURRENTPAGEHWND retourne la valeur null. Vous pouvez ensuite récupérer la valeur qu’une feuille de propriétés modale aurait reçue de feuille en envoyant un message PSM _ .

Notes

Ce message n’est pas pris en charge lors de l’utilisation du style de l’Assistant Aero (PSH _ AEROWIZARD).

Spécifications

Condition requise Valeur
Client minimal pris en charge
Windows [Applications de bureau Vista uniquement]
Serveur minimal pris en charge
Windows Serveur 2003 [ applications de bureau uniquement]
En-tête
Prsht. h